kk před 2 týdny
rodič
revize
e4c0b5ad53

+ 1 - 1
game-business/src/main/java/com/game/business/controller/AppGameBettingController.java

@@ -155,7 +155,7 @@ public class AppGameBettingController extends BaseController{
             }
         }
 
-        BigDecimal gameBettingAmountCheck = new BigDecimal("0");
+        BigDecimal gameBettingAmountCheck = new BigDecimal(appGame.getBettingMaxMoney() + "");
         BigDecimal gameBettingAmountSum = appGameBettingService.getBettingAmount(gameBetting.getUserId(), gameBetting.getGameId(), appGame.getGameDate(), null);
         BigDecimal gameBettingAmountAdd = gameBettingAmountSum.add(new BigDecimal(gameBetting.getBettingAmount() + ""));
         if(gameBettingAmountAdd.compareTo(gameBettingAmountCheck) == 1){

+ 1 - 1
game-business/src/main/resources/mapper/business/AppGameBettingMapper.xml

@@ -83,7 +83,7 @@
         select
             ifnull(sum(betting_amount), 0.00) as bettingAmount
         from app_game_betting where user_id = #{userId} and game_id = #{gameId} and game_date = #{gameDate}
-        <if test="bettingItem != null">
+        <if test="bettingItem != null and bettingItem != ''">
             and betting_item = #{bettingItem}
         </if>
     </select>